Conference summaries: Healing and Exorcism in Second Temple Judaism and Early Christianity

This is Rikard Roitto, me and Tommy Wasserman (left to right as you look) listening hard to a fascinating presentation by Anthony John Lappin of Maynooth on the moving of relics in the early Christian centuries during this conference last week in Örebro, Sweden.

The organisers have now made a very helpful summary in English of this excellent conference available here, as well as a nice short video (with English translation of the bits of Swedish).

Larry Hurtado has also blogged about his (excellent) paper on the role of name of Jesus in healing and exorcism (and much else) here.

The slides from my talk on why Jesus and Paul command silence in two interesting stories in Luke and Acts are available here.

The papers will be published in due course in Mohr Siebeck’s WUNT 2 series—look out for them!
